Introduction to the Training:
This comprehensive 5-day training program is designed to equip participants with the essential tools, techniques, and best practices of successful project management. Through a mix of theory, hands-on exercises, real-world scenarios, and simulations, participants will navigate the full project lifecycle—from initiation and planning to execution, monitoring, and closure.
Whether managing small tasks or large-scale initiatives, this program will help you build the competencies needed to lead projects with confidence, efficiency, and professionalism. It offers a practical and immersive learning experience, ensuring you’re ready to apply your knowledge immediately in your workplace.
- Training Outlines:
– Project Management Overview – Understanding the scope, value, and key phases.
– Breakdown Structure (WBS) – Breaking down projects into manageable tasks.
– Project Initiation and Planning – Setting a strong foundation for successful delivery.
– Project Management Tools – Introduction to practical tools for managing time, tasks, and teams.
– Charts, PERT Diagrams, and Kanban Boards – Visual tools for planning and tracking progress.
– Critical Path Method (CPM) – Identifying the longest stretch of dependent activities.
– Resource Allocation and Leveling – Optimizing the use of people and tools.
– Project Charter & Scope Definition – Formalizing project intentions and boundaries.
– Developing Project Schedules – Creating timelines and forecasting delivery.
– Risk Management Fundamentals – Ident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ks.
– Project Execution and Monitoring – Keeping projects on track and aligned.
– Project Management Software – Exploring digital tools for automation and tracking.
– Effective Project Communication – Ensuring clear, structured, and consistent updates.
– Stakeholder Identification and Analysis – Managing expectations and engagement.
– Conflict Resolution in Projects – Addressing issues before they derail progress.
– Project Closure & Continuous Improvement – Finalizing deliverables and learning from experience.
– Project Management Ethics & Professionalism – Leading with integrity and responsibility.
